What is an iGaming Aggregator?

An iGaming aggregator is a technological platform or middleware that connects online casino operators with several game content suppliers through a single combination.

Generally, if a casino operator wanted to include video games from ten various studios (such as NetEnt, Evolution, Pragmatic Play, and Microgaming), they needed to work out 10 different agreements, construct 10 private technical combinations, manage ten billing cycles, and handle 10 sets of compliance guidelines.

An aggregator fixes this fragmentation. By incorporating with an aggregator's API (Application Programming Interface), an operator gains instant access to a vast portfolio of video games from lots-- often hundreds-- of software developers through a single contract and a single technical connection.


How Does an iGaming Aggregator Work?

At its core, the Jackpot Aggregator acts as a bridge between the Game Provider (B2B) and the Casino Operator (B2C).

  1. The Game Provider establishes the video games and hosts them on their servers.
  2. The Aggregator develops a partnership with the provider and links their game library into the aggregator's main center by means of API.
  3. The Casino Operator integrates the aggregator's unified API into their casino platform.
  4. The Player visits the casino website, clicks on a game, and the request is flawlessly routed through the aggregator to the game provider's server in real-time.

Benefits of Using an iGaming Aggregator

The advantages of making use of an aggregation platform extend far beyond basic benefit. Both start-up operators and market giants rely on aggregators for a number of key factors:

  • Speed to Market: Instead of costs months or years incorporating individual game suppliers one by one, operators can introduce a fully equipped casino lobby in weeks.
  • Expense Efficiency: Developing and maintaining several API connections needs considerable IT resources. Aggregators dramatically lower development overhead and legal costs.
  • Huge Content Variety: Players get bored quickly. Aggregators make sure that operators can easily revitalize their lobbies with the most recent releases throughout all verticals.
  • Simplified Financial Management: Instead of processing dozens of micro-transactions and billings from different suppliers, operators manage financial reconciliation through a single partner.
  • Advanced Back-Office Tools: Many modern aggregators supply effective analytics, promotional tools (such as tournaments and complimentary spins engines), and perk management systems that work across multiple game suppliers.

Secret Features to Look for in an iGaming Aggregator

Not all aggregation platforms are created equal. When examining potential partners, B2C operators generally search for the following criteria:

  • Portfolio Diversity: Does the aggregator provide a healthy mix of slots, table video games, live casino, and localized material?
  • API Stability and Uptime: A sluggish API causes game lag, which drives players away. High performance and 99.9% uptime are non-negotiable.
  • Regulative Compliance: The aggregator ought to support qualified games that comply with major jurisdictions (e.g., MGA, UKGC, Curacao).
  • Seamless Wallet Support: The capability to support instantaneous balance updates and secure deals across all integrated games.
  • Scalability: The platform should have the ability to deal with high volumes of concurrent players without dropping performance throughout peak wagering hours.

Regularly Asked Questions (FAQ)

1. What is the difference in between an iGaming aggregator and a white-label platform?

A white-label option supplies an all-in-one turnkey online casino, including the betting license, payment gateways, hosting, client support, and the game material (frequently through an aggregator). An iGaming aggregator, on the other hand, just supplies the game content layer. Operators who use an aggregator usually develop their own front-end platform and hold their own video gaming licenses.

2. How do aggregators earn money?

Aggregators normally run on a Revenue Share (RevShare) design. They take a little percentage of the Gross Gaming Revenue (GGR) produced by the games played through their platform, passing the rest to the operator and the game studio. Some may likewise charge initial setup costs or month-to-month platform fees depending upon the agreement structure.

3. Can I include my own exclusive games to an iGaming aggregator?

Yes. Numerous sophisticated aggregators use custom-made integration services, allowing game studios or large operators with exclusive software to distribute their video games through the aggregator's network to other operators.

4. Do aggregators affect game RTP (Return to Player)?

No. Aggregators do not change the math designs, volatility, or RTP of the video games. The video games are hosted firmly on the game service provider's remote servers (RGS), and the aggregator simply serves as the safe conduit for information and bets.
